## Build Provenance: Sort Stability in Lanternfold Reports

Last sprint we traced inconsistent row ordering in Lanternfold's report builder to an unstable sort in the aggregation pass. Rows with equal keys could swap between builds, breaking snapshot diffs. We switched to a stable merge sort and pinned the comparator version in the provenance manifest, so every report can be traced to the exact sorter revision. The verified build token follows.

trace token, fafog-kageg: htk4_98e6

LEADERSHIP REVIEW BRIEFING — Regional Sales, Orvantis Group

For branch managers. Q2 results: Northvale up 9%, Caldmere flat, Renwick down 6% on lost wholesale accounts. Margins held at 31% despite freight pressure. Actions: Renwick gets a dedicated recovery team; Caldmere pilots the bundled-pricing trial; Northvale staffing increase approved. Leadership expects corrective plans filed within ten days. Keep figures internal until the earnings call. Context for these moves sits in the confidential note directly below.

confidential, kagup-bafog: Fraaxax Group is in early talks to buy Soroxox Group for about $343.8 million. The Olidor launch date is June 14, and nothing goes to the press before then. Legal wants the Aldmirek Logistics term sheet signed before July 23.

## Order Cutoff

Crumbline enforces a daily cutoff for next-day bakery orders. Plugins must not accept orders past the cutoff; the core rejects them anyway, and the rejection is not overridable. Cutoff evaluation uses the store's local clock, never the customer's. Grace handling exists only for in-flight checkouts. All relevant constants are defined below.

tuning table, yajog-yahof:
BUDGETS = {
    "lamvan": 303,
    "wenox": 460,
    "fenvan": 525,
}

Franchise Agreement — Caldreth Provisions (Managers Only)

The renewed franchise agreement with Caldreth Provisions takes effect next quarter. Royalty rates move to a tiered structure, and territory exclusivity now covers the Brindlemoor region only. Heads of department should align staffing and supply plans accordingly. Department heads must also review the confidential planning note below before briefing their teams.

internal memo for yahag-tahog: The pricing group signed off on a budget of $152.8 million for Project Soriel.